Overview

BAS-2 is a selective, mechanism-based small molecule inhibitor of histone deacetylase 6 (HDAC6) with a unique isothiouronium core. Discovered through a phenotypic small-molecule screen targeting triple-negative breast cancer (TNBC) cells, BAS-2 selectively kills cancer cells independent of mitochondrial apoptosis. It acts as a prodrug that undergoes intracellular hydrolysis to generate a mercaptoacetamide active species, which directly coordinates with the catalytic zinc ion of human HDAC6. BAS-2 has been shown to reduce glycolytic metabolism, alter mitochondrial cristae structure, and inhibit tumor cell migration, invasion, and spheroid formation in TNBC models.
